    Chicken Chili Recipe

    Ingredients:

    • 2 pounds chicken breast
    • 2 cans Rotel (undrained)
    • 2 cans corn (undrained)
    • 2 cans pinto beans (drained & rinsed)
    • 2 cans black beans (drained & rinsed)
    • 1 large onion, chopped
    • 2 cups chicken broth
    • 2 tbsp chili powder
    • 1 tbsp cumin
    • 2 tsp salt
    • 1 tsp pepper
    • 2 packets ranch seasoning mix
    • 16 ounces cream cheese (2 bricks)

    Instructions:

    1. Start by placing the chicken breasts at the bottom of your crock pot.
    2. Pour the cans of Rotel and corn (with their juices) over the chicken.
    3. Add the drained and rinsed pinto beans and black beans, then toss in the chopped onion.
    4. Next, pour in the chicken broth and sprinkle the chili powder, cumin, salt, and pepper on top.
    5. Open up the ranch seasoning packets and stir them into the mix.
    6. Lastly, place the two blocks of cream cheese on top of the ingredients without stirring.
    7. Set your crock pot to high for 4 hours or low for 8 hours, depending on your schedule.
    8. Once the cooking time is up, shred the chicken breasts using two forks and mix the shredded chicken back into the chili.
    9. Give everything a good stir to incorporate the melted cream cheese evenly throughout the chili.
    10. Serve warm with your favorite toppings like shredded cheese, sour cream, or a sprinkle of fresh cilantro.

    For your Chicken Chili recipe featuring ingredients like cream cheese, Rotel, and ranch seasoning, I found several great sources that provide similar recipes and helpful tips for perfecting this dish.

    The general approach of layering chicken with canned ingredients like beans, corn, and tomatoes, then adding ranch seasoning and cream cheese on top, is common across many chicken chili variations. One key tip is ensuring the cream cheese melts smoothly by stirring the chili halfway through cooking, which helps achieve a creamy consistency​(The Recipe Critic)​(Key to My Lime).

    Many recipes recommend cooking the chili on low for 6-8 hours or high for 4-6 hours to allow the flavors to blend fully. Shredding the chicken at the end of the cooking time and stirring it back into the chili helps distribute the flavors evenly​(Salt & Baker)​(The Recipe Critic).

    If you're looking for customization ideas, you could experiment with additional spices like garlic powder or green chilies for extra heat, or adjust the level of creaminess by using full-fat cream cheese. This dish also freezes well, making it a convenient make-ahead meal​(Salt & Baker).
